Abstract

The invention discloses an automobile chassis dynamometer support and belongs to the field of automobile performance test equipment. The automobile chassis dynamometer support comprises a rack. Two detection rollers and two supporting rollers are arranged on the rack. A driving box is arranged between the two detection rollers. The side end of a driving gear is provided with a protective cover, wherein the shafts of the detection rollers and the shafts of the supporting rollers stretch into the protective cover. A friction plate, a pressing block and a first spring are arranged in the protective cover. The friction plate is fixed at the shaft ends of the detection rollers and the shaft ends of the supporting rollers. The pressing block is arranged on the shafts of the detection rollers andthe shafts of the supporting rollers in a sleeved mode. The first spring is connected between the pressing block and the protective cover. A shaft sleeve is arranged on the shafts of the detection rollers and the shafts of the supporting rollers. A pull rope is arranged between the shaft sleeve and the pressing block. A clamping groove is formed in the shaft sleeve. A guide rod is arranged on therack on the outer side of the detection rollers. A rack is arranged outside the guide rod. An idler wheel is arranged on the guide rod. One end, close to the driving box, of the rack is fixedly provided with a pulling plate. A clamping opening is formed in the pulling plate. The clamping opening is clamped in the clamping groove. According to the technical scheme of the invention, the problem that an existing chassis dynamometer cannot simulate the automobile steering condition in the prior art can be solved.

technical field [0001] The invention relates to the field of automobile performance testing equipment, in particular to an automobile chassis dynamometer support. Background technique [0002] Automobile chassis dynamometer is an important experimental equipment for automobiles. It is a desktop experimental system for completing automobile experiments. It can simulate road loads in various working conditions of automobile road experiments, and complete automobile economic tests, power tests, and emission performance indoors. Special experiments related to analysis, reliability experiments and automobile transmission are necessary large-scale equipment for automobile experimental research, product development, and quality inspection. Compared with ordinary road experiments, it is more effective to use automobile chassis dynamometers to complete automobile experiments indoors.
